Tuesday 15 November 2011

More Knox on the market this week! 177 Progress Road Eltham was designed by Alistair Knox and built in 1970. It features his trademark solid materials of Robertson style bricks and exposed timber beams juxtaposed with extensive glazing. The idea of the 'Hearth' is central to Knox's designs and there are several fireplaces, flanked by terracotta floors and even original bathrooms (which have stood the test of time rather well - concealed cistern toilets and all!!)

Friday 11 November 2011

Seymour Spectacular

What a spectacular property to finish the week on! Wow, wow, wow!! And MR and I thought our garden was big! Try 6.75 undulating acres including banks of the Plenty River. 

27-35 Seymour Grove Viewbank is a short walk from the Lower Plenty Hotel (but hey, don't let that disuade you!) It was designed in the 60's by architect Charles Duncan who was the winner of the Royal Australian Institute of Architects (Vic.) Single House award (1965 for 4 Glenard Drive, Heidelberg) and was also involved in the Elliston Estate, Rosanna).

This superb mid-century house features extensive glazing, Daniel Robertson style bricks, original slate floors and that double sided open fireplace. Think I'll go check it out this weekend! 
Perfectly sited in the landscape

Yes, that double sided open fireplace!! Floating hearth, slate floors. Fab.
